It's very easy to forget where I am with the status of each piece, especially when they're all at different stages--some need to be fired for the first time, others need to get drier before I can trim them, and yet others need to be picked up from the completed shelf.
That's why I take photos after each visit to the studio. Without a visual reminder, I'd forget what I did. I've also started making notes in a notebook.
Though I wish I didn't have to be so detailed, I've found this is the only way I can work.
